Caspian Tern with Forster's Tern and American Avocet chick

Radio Road, Redwood Shores

The Caspian is the (male?) partner of an incubating bird; the Avocet chick, in camouflage plumage, is in the lower right. Caspian Terns average 21" long to 13" for Forster's, outweigh them 660 g to 160.
